About The Position

As a Compliance Audit Specialist, you will play a critical role in supporting Alerus’ responsibilities as a Pooled Plan Provider for Pooled Employer Plans and beyond. This position is responsible for monitoring, tracking, and documenting compliance requirements to ensure adherence to ERISA, IRS, and Department of Labor regulations. This role partners closely with cross-functional teams to ensure that obligations are completed accurately, timely, and in accordance with established procedures. The position emphasizes strong organization, attention to detail, and the ability to manage multiple compliance requirements in a structured and controlled environment with some audit background.

Responsibilities

  • Maintain and update centralized tracking tools for PPP/audit compliance responsibilities, including deadlines, deliverables, and supporting documentation.
  • Monitor completion of PPP/audit activities and follow up with internal teams to ensure timely execution and oversight.
  • Maintain documentation supporting the PPP’s role as a named fiduciary and Plan Administrator.
  • Identify potential compliance risks or process gaps and escalate as appropriate.
  • Support development and maintenance of standard operating procedures related to PPP and audit responsibilities.
  • Coordinate with internal partners to ensure accurate and consistent handling of compliance-related processes.
  • Contribute to ongoing process improvement initiatives to enhance efficiency and strengthen controls.
